Filmmaker Ryan Coogler is currently experiencing a surge in success with his recent supernatural horror production titled “Sinners“, which could potentially impact the continuation of his Black Panther films within the Marvel Cinematic Universe. In a recent interview, Coogler expressed his perspectives on where his filmmaking journey might lead next.
In conversation with Coogler, he mentioned that Sinners stands out from his previous projects spanning the past decade. When inquired if he wishes to return to franchise films such as Black Panther, Coogler’s reaction was nuanced. He expressed, “It’s just that not everyone can create this kind of work, so I feel a sense of responsibility too. Of course, I aspire to make more films like Sinners, but the filmmakers I admire greatly are the ones who produce such pieces,” he added.
He stated that they create unique films on a grand scale, and he believes each production moves the medium forward. He also said, “If the audience enjoys the movie and finds a spot for me among those successful films.” Although Coogler is renowned for “Black Panther” and its sequel, “Sinners” is fast becoming another prized piece in his film collection; it has garnered significant attention since its release earlier this month.
In the movie titled “Sinners,” twin brothers, portrayed by the same actors, seek a new beginning in their hometown of Mississippi Delta. However, they stumble upon an ominous supernatural presence that has been lying in wait for them. Alongside them, Hailee Steinfeld, Miles Caton, and Jack O’Connell take on other significant roles. Notably, this project is the first entirely original work by Ryan Coogler; his previous projects like “Black Panther” and “Creed” were spin-offs from pre-existing franchises.
What Do Coogler’s Comments Mean for the Future of Black Panther?
Ryan Coogler has voiced his intentions to create more self-generated movies down the line; however, it appears that he may not completely step away from the Black Panther series. There have been talks about his potential involvement in a future installment of the franchise, suggesting that he has numerous concepts for where the third movie might be headed. At this moment, there’s no specific information or release date available regarding Black Panther 3.
Working on Black Panther 3 might make the movie even more captivating, as Coogler discussed his apprehensions about filmmaking and how he overcame them for his latest project. When working with established franchises, there’s a certain level of protection that comes in; it reduces some of the pressure. The downside is, you can hide behind this protection. However, I wanted to challenge myself by not relying on this comfort zone. Instead, I decided to take risks with this project.
